Pierre Cordier (politician)

Pierre Cordier (politician)

French politician


Pierre Cordier (born 27 May 1972) is a French politician of the Republicans (LR)[1] who has been serving as a member of the French National Assembly since 18 June 2017, representing the 2nd constituency of the department of Ardennes.[2]

Political career

Cordier serves as the Shadow Minister for Labour and Training in the shadow cabinet of France.[3] Ahead of the Republicans’ 2022 convention, he endorsed Éric Ciotti as the party's chairman.[4]
